Unfortunately I've gone the other way recently and have run all internal pumps just until last year when I got my first external Reeflo Dart. I've run Mag drives,Quiet Ones, eheims, for the most part and they all sieze up over time due to the the calcification that builds up in the impellers. As long as you have a regular vinegar soaking schedule I haven't found any that didn't exhibit this issue. If someone has found a new pump that has found a fix to this problem I'd love to hear about it.

When I ran my 2 Quiet One 9000s plumbed in parallel I at least had a backup all the time so I can disconnect the one that seized up to soak. That got old fast though.
